Role Description The Assistant Manager at LOFT Eden Prairie Center supports the Store Manager in leading daily store operations and driving a customer-focused environment. This full-time, on-site role in the Greater Minneapolis–St. Paul Area includes coaching and mentoring associates, modeling inclusive and engaging service standards, and ensuring the sales floor is visually appealing and well-maintained. The Assistant Manager helps manage scheduling, opening and closing procedures, cash handling, and adherence to company policies and loss prevention practices. This role partners closely with store leadership to achieve sales goals, monitor key performance indicators, and execute promotions and merchandising updates. The Assistant Manager also supports hiring, onboarding, performance feedback, and fosters a culture of teamwork, wellbeing, and positive energy.
